> > > So let me redo the questions:
> > >
> > > How does the P bit enabling works? Who/what causes it and why?
> >
> > To add to what Phil said, the current implementation sets PULL bit
> > like this:
> >
> > ...
> >         else if (routeInfo.parent == INVALID_ADDR) {
> >             beaconMsg->etx = routeInfo.etx;
> >             beaconMsg->options |= CTP_OPT_PULL;
> >         } else {
> > ...
> >
> > (When a node does not have a parent, for example, when a node boots
> > up.)

> > > The question about the 14 data messages remain.
> > >
> >
> > Did you disable the debug messages? Those messages on the serial
> > interface are probably debug messages. CTP should not send bogus
> > messages on the serial port - if the tree is built, it will send data
> > messages, otherwise there will be no data messages to forward. Debug
> > messages are independent of the data messages and if they are enabled,
> > not only the base station, but all the motes should send some debug
> > messages on the serial port.
